According to the epilouge on JLa's book,

"Che's friend Alberto Grando remains in Cuba. Now in his mid-seventies, he is a sprightly grandfatherly figure who retains a taste for rum and good tangos. Venerated as Che's "friend", he has published a few books about his relationship with Che and travels the world giving talks about their experiences together."
